Output 8e4fcde8192f463a8929d53fa2ae7a89a2a77eea48e6e3f893b3caa31aa43517:1

value
536293
script pubkey
OP_0 OP_PUSHBYTES_20 6faf33b5dec2741938714ffc9fb3106735f104ba
address
bc1qd7hn8dw7cf6pjwr3fl7flvcsvu6lzp96avx6xx
transaction
8e4fcde8192f463a8929d53fa2ae7a89a2a77eea48e6e3f893b3caa31aa43517
confirmations
17112
spent
true